The 4K disc will be a 100GB disc that includes HDR10 high dynamic range and English Dolby Atmos audio. The film will be presented in the 2.39:1 aspect ratio. Subtitles on the 4K will include English SDH, French, and Spanish.Newly-produced extras on the 4K disc will include:
- Physical Media Introduction with Kevin Smith (3 mins)
- the Revelations: Making Dogma documentary (80 mins)
- Establishing Shot with Robert Yeoman (3 mins)
- Dogma Q&A (26 mins)
- More Sermons from the Mount (20 mins)
- Original Theatrical Trailer
- 25th Anniversary Teaser & Theatrical Trailer
- Audio Commentary with Kevin Smith, Ben Affleck, Jason Lee, Jason Mewes, Scott Mosier and Vincent Pereira
- Technical Audio Commentary with Kevin Smith, Scott Mosier and Vincent Pereira
The Blu-ray (a BD50, Region A) will offer English Dolby Atmos audio, English SDH, French, and Spanish subtitles, and the following legacy extras (most of them in SD):
- Physical Media Introduction with Kevin Smith (3 mins) – NEW
- 25th Anniversary Teaser & Theatrical Trailer – NEW
- Audio Commentary with Kevin Smith, Ben Affleck, Jason Lee, Jason Mewes, Scott Mosier and Vincent Pereira with optional video hijinks
- Technical Audio Commentary with Kevin Smith, Scott Mosier and Vincent Pereira
- Deleted Scenes with Intros (97 mins)
- Outtakes (13 mins)
- Jay and Silent Bob Secret Stash Commercial (2 mins)
- Judge Not: In Defense of Dogma (2001 Documentary) (37 mins)
- Original Theatrical Trailer (2:34)
- Storyboards (3 sequences)
- Original PSP Introduction with Kevin Smith (4 mins)
- ShoWest Sizzle (:48)
- Easter Egg – How Jay Thinks Kevin Directs (1:59)
- Easter Egg – How Kevin Directs (2:15)
- My Opinion by Mrs. Harriet Wise (4:14)
- UK Teaser Trailer (:20)
- TV Spot – US (:30)
- TV Spots – UK (:23) (2 spots)
